Tennis Earns ITA All-Academic Team Awards as 15 Lynx Earn Scholar-Athlete Honors

7/24/2025 4:04:00 PM

The Rhodes College tennis teams have been named to the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) All-Academic Team, and fifteen players were named ITA Scholar-Athletes. 

In 2025, 1,115 Division III men's student-athletes were named an ITA Scholar-Athlete, and 135 men's tennis programs were awarded the All-Academic Team distinction. 

In 2025, 1,269 Division III women's student-athletes were named an ITA Scholar-Athlete, and 165 women's tennis programs were awarded the All-Academic Team honor. 

To be named an ITA Scholar-athlete, students must have a GPA of at least 3.5 for the current academic year and be listed on the institutional eligibility form. To be named an ITA All-Academic Team, programs must have a team GPA of 3.2 or above. 

Nicholas Miloi, Christian Mainella, Oliver Bonovich, Cole McNair, Eli Felker, Paul Fridman, and Jacob Lehmann have garnered ITA Scholar-Athlete honors for the men. 

Sofia Rodriguez, Taylor Nash, Lilly Higgins, Anna Rush, Cami Lowry, Emma McHale, Gracie Rask, and Zainab Baba received ITA Scholar-Athlete recognition for the women.
